Hi Guys,

is there a way to play ScummVM on the current PadOs (iPad Pro) without Jailbreak?
I've found this guide: https://wiki.scummvm.org/index.php/Comp ... mVM/iPhone

Before I try to follow these instructions i got some questions:
1. Does it work on the new PadOs?
2. Is it right that ScummVM will only work for 7 days?
3. If its doesnt work after 7 days, is it hard to "recompile" the scummvm app? How long does this take?
I havent done this before so i cannot imagine how much work this and how long it takes if you're a newbie.

Thanks a lot for your help.

1. I don't know for sure as I am not familiar with iPadOS but I think it should work.
2. Yes, that is correct (unless you have a paid Apple Developer account).
3. If you are recompiling the same version (and not updating to the latest source code) it s very easy and fast. You just have to connect your iPad to your computer, open the ScummVM.xcodeproj again, and hit the play button (to compile and deploy ScummVM to your iPad again). Since it should have kept the result of the previous compilation, it actually doesn't have anything to recompile, so it should be a lot faster than the first compilation.

Yes, I think the compilation instructions on the wiki should have everything you need, although it may lack some details for some of the steps.

When you rebuild ScummVM, the one on your iPad will be updated and keep all the games and save states you have. Those are only lost if you remove the ScummVM app from your iPad.
